Mary Pond, the daughter of Joshua and Jane (Ball) Pond. She was born on 8 November 1748 in Roxbury, Suffolk County, Massachusetts and was christened on 13 November 1748 in Roxbury, Suffolk County, Massachusetts. She and Jonathan Ward filed marriage intentions on 20 September 1772 in Newton, Middlesex County, Massachusetts. She died on Sunday 6 July 1777 in Athol, now Orange, Franklin County, Massachusetts.
